Bass Pro Shops is seeking a Shipping Driver to accurately pull products from warehouse inventory, stage them for shipping, and load shipments into trucks while following safety guidelines. A valid Class E license is required and forklift certification is preferred.
The role involves transporting finished goods to customers and vendors, performing system transactions, and ensuring accurate counts through audits. Physical requirements include lifting up to 59 lbs and frequent travel.
The Shipping Driver accurately pulls products from warehouse inventory, staging or kitting, and uses safety guidelines to load shipments into trucks and trailers. Requires valid class E license for deliveries by following laws and regulations to various facilities.
Pulls product from warehouse inventory rack locations and stages in kit racking or finished goods dock area. Transports finished goods to customer, suppliers, or vendors in a safe and lawful manner. Loads products from shipping dock onto trucks. Performs systematic transactions of transfers, invoicing, receiving, and issuing. Processes shipments through multiple systems for distribution orders. Verifies part numbers and counts, calculates total skids shipped daily and provides weekly audits to verify count accuracies. ALL OTHER DUTIES AS ASSIGNED

Bass Pro Shops is North America's premier outdoor and conservation company. Founded in 1972 when avid young angler Johnny Morris began selling tackle out of his father's liquor store in Springfield, Missouri, today the company provides customers with unmatched offerings spanning premier destination retail, outdoor equipment manufacturing, world-class resort destinations and more. In 2017 Bass Pro Shops joined forces with Cabela's to create a "best-of-the-best" experience with superior products, dynamic locations and outstanding customer service. Bass Pro Shops also operates White River Marine Group, offering an unsurpassed collection of industry-leading boat brands, and Big Cedar Lodge, America's Premier Wilderness Resort.
